The Formation of Def Leppard
The formation of Def Leppard wasn't an overnight success. It took time, effort, and a lot of experimentation to get the band to where it is today. The original lineup went through several iterations before settling on the final configuration.
In the beginning, the band was known as Atomic Mass, but they soon realized that name didn't quite fit their vision. After some brainstorming, they settled on Def Leppard, a name that has since become synonymous with rock music.

The Major Breakthrough
The major breakthrough for Def Leppard came with the release of their debut album, "On Through the Night." This album showcased the band's talent and potential, earning them a dedicated fanbase and critical acclaim.
With tracks like "Wasted" and "Hello America," the band proved that they were here to stay, and their star began to rise rapidly. The original members played a crucial role in this success, laying the foundation for the band's future achievements.
